South Asian Women's Rights Organization
About
The South Asian Women’s Rights Organization (SAWRO) is a community-based and community led association of immigrant women living in the neighbourhood of Oakridge and Crescent Town (Danforth Avenue and Victoria Park Avenue). Since being founded by the community’s women in 2007, SAWRO has worked for the empowerment and integration of immigrant women and for the reduction of poverty within the community. Their programs include settlement services, youth activities, and a job network.
